Abstract

ChatGPT (Chat Generative Pre-trained Transformer) is an artificial intelligence chatbot that uses a technology transformer to predict the following sentences or words in a chat or text. ChatGPT has begun to be widely used in pharmacy services to obtain information about disease, treatment, and patient therapy. However, it has not yet been discovered to what extent the safety and effectiveness of ChatGPT in helping pharmacists for the treatment process and patient care. This article review aims to summarize, evaluate and find the gaps in the research that has been done so that a better understanding of the role of ChatGPT is obtained to optimize its use in pharmaceutical services appropriately. Using English-language publications that were published and connected to ChatGPT and pharmacy services in 2023, the study used a multi-method qualitative approach, ProQuest, and ScienceDirect databases. ChatGPT shows excellent results in helping pharmacists give counselling and bringing immense potential in optimizing pharmacy services and in making clinical decision support. But ChatGPT can’t give accurate and safe information, can’t understand pharmacists’ instructions or explain adverse drug reactions and their causes. The ChatGPT answer shows no signs of reproducibility to low reproducibility.   ChatGPT is a helpful technology, but not a professional medical advisor that can substitute such as a pharmacist. ChatGPT’s output must be validated before decision usage for the safety and efficacy of the treatment.
